Key Factors in Activewear Fabric Selection

When selecting fabrics for activewear, several factors must be considered to ensure the final product meets performance expectations and market demands. These include:

1. Performance Characteristics

  • Moisture Wicking: Fabrics that pull sweat away from the skin, such as polyester blends, are essential for high-intensity workouts.
  • Breathability: Mesh panels or fabrics with micro-perforations enhance airflow, keeping the body cool.
  • Stretch and Recovery: Spandex (elastane) provides the necessary stretch, while high recovery ensures the garment retains its shape.
  • Durability: Abrasion resistance is crucial for activities like running or gym training.
  • Comfort: Softness against the skin and flatlock seams prevent chafing.
  • 2. Fabric Composition

    Common fibers used in activewear include:

  • Polyester: Known for durability and moisture-wicking properties.
  • Nylon: Offers excellent elasticity and strength, often used in leggings.
  • Spandex/Elastane: Provides stretch and recovery, usually blended in small percentages.
  • Natural Fibers: Bamboo, cotton, or merino wool for eco-friendly options, though they may require special treatments for performance.
  • 3. Weight and Thickness

    Fabric weight (measured in GSM – grams per square meter) affects the garment's feel and function. Lightweight fabrics (150-200 GSM) are ideal for summer wear, while mid-weight (200-300 GSM) offers more support and coverage.

    OEM and ODM Manufacturing: How Fabric Selection Differs

    Understanding the distinction between OEM and ODM is vital when collaborating with manufacturers.

  • OEM (Original Equipment Manufacturer): You provide the fabric specifications, and the manufacturer produces according to your exact requirements. This gives you full control over fabric choice but requires a clear understanding of your needs.
  • ODM (Original Design Manufacturer): The manufacturer offers pre-developed fabric options and designs. This is faster and often more cost-effective, as the manufacturer has already tested the fabrics.
  • The Role of MOQ in Fabric Selection

    MOQ (Minimum Order Quantity) is a critical factor that impacts fabric selection. Manufacturers often have MOQs for custom fabrics, which can range from 500 to 3,000 meters. If your order is below the MOQ, you may be limited to standard in-stock fabrics.     Quality Control: Ensuring Fabric Integrity

    Quality control is non-negotiable in activewear manufacturing. A robust QC process ensures that fabrics meet specified standards for colorfastness, shrinkage, tensile strength, and pilling resistance. Key QC checkpoints include:

  • Incoming Fabric Inspection: Verifying that received materials match the approved samples.
  • In-Line Inspection: Monitoring production to catch issues early.
  • Final Random Inspection: Checking finished garments for defects before shipment.

    Industry Standards and Certifications

    Adhering to international standards is essential for global distribution. Look for certifications such as:

  • OEKO-TEX Standard 100: Ensures fabrics are free from harmful substances.
  • Global Organic Textile Standard (GOTS): For organic fibers.
  • ISO 9001: Quality management systems.
  • These certifications not only guarantee quality but also enhance brand credibility.

    Common Mistakes in Fabric Selection for OEM/ODM

    Avoid these pitfalls to ensure a successful product launch:

  • Ignoring the End-User: Selecting fabrics based solely on cost or aesthetics without considering the target activity can lead to poor performance.
  • Overlooking Testing: Skipping fabric testing for shrinkage or colorfastness can result in customer complaints.
  • Underestimating MOQ Implications: Not planning for MOQs can delay production or force compromises on fabric choice.
  • Neglecting Sustainability: Consumers are increasingly eco-conscious; ignoring sustainable options may harm your brand image.
  • Lack of Communication: Failing to clearly communicate your requirements to the manufacturer can lead to misunderstandings and subpar products.

    FAQ

    What is the ideal MOQ for custom activewear fabrics?

    The MOQ for custom fabrics typically ranges from 500 to 1,000 meters per color, depending on the manufacturer. Some, like luckyyoga, offer lower MOQs for ODM clients using existing fabric collections.

    How does quality control affect fabric selection?

    Quality control ensures that the selected fabric meets performance and safety standards. A robust QC process can identify issues like shrinkage or color fading before production, saving time and costs.

    Can I use sustainable fabrics without increasing costs?

    Yes, many manufacturers now offer sustainable fabrics at competitive prices, especially when ordered in bulk. Additionally, some eco-friendly materials can be blended with conventional fibers to balance cost and performance.

    What is the difference between OEM and ODM in activewear?

    In OEM, the brand provides fabric specifications and design, and the manufacturer produces accordingly. In ODM, the manufacturer offers pre-designed fabrics and styles, which the brand can customize. ODM is often faster and more cost-effective.

    How long does fabric development take?

    Custom fabric development can take 4-8 weeks, including sample creation and testing. Using existing fabrics from a manufacturer's library can reduce this to 1-2 weeks.
